> It seems to always fail on Loongson buildds but never on others.
> 
> Based on how it fails, I suspect mariadb-10.1 on mips64el is
> completely broken on Loongson.

It looks like this is #843926 ("jemalloc uses a hard coded page size
detected during build"). I can reproduce this bug on an Broadcom XLP
machine so it isn't Loongson specific. Both the Loongson buildds and the
XLP use 16K pages whereas the Octeon buildds use 4K pages. Also the
reproducer in message #61 in the above bug report also segfaults on the
Loongsons.
